Output 2c837ee3c381fc4325a3bd6a1d5bd7da23bc63c2500bc986bd2cd28a0fe564eb:2

value
40292612
script pubkey
OP_0 OP_PUSHBYTES_20 1e709bd5d403b28eec23555abf006d2046ac782e
address
bc1qrecfh4w5qwegampr24dt7qrdypr2c7pww9gy8x
transaction
2c837ee3c381fc4325a3bd6a1d5bd7da23bc63c2500bc986bd2cd28a0fe564eb
confirmations
1909
spent
true